Cathy Berlinger-Gustafson is a senior consultant for Learning Forward. In her work with schools, districts, and state education agencies, Cathy designs and facilitates presentations, workshops and trainings. Her work includes school and organizational change, professional development processes and systems, and coaching, as well as other topics that support continuous improvement in education.

Cathy has served as a mentor for the Learning Forward Academy and as the Learning Forward Annual Conference Planning Committee facilitator. In 2001, she received the Distinguished Service Award from the National Staff Development Council (now Learning Forward).

Prior to consulting, Cathy taught elementary, middle and high school students, was an elementary principal and curriculum director. She has worked in suburban schools, urban schools and in the Department of Defense schools overseas in Okinawa, Japan and Hahn, Germany.

Our mission

The Learning Forward Foundation supports the development of educators' capacity to improve student learning through innovation and improvement that transforms professional learning, framed by the Learning Forward's Standards for Professional Learning and implemented with a coherent design through grants, scholarships, and professional support.
